  • What is included in the retreat price?

    Your registration includes lodging for the retreat dates (Thursday evening through Saturday night; checking out Sunday), lovingly prepared meals, guided yoga and meditation practices, facilitated group experiences, and access to nature-based wellness activities. Some retreats may also include art workshops, hikes, or special guest teachings. Travel to/from the retreat location and optional add-ons are not included.

    Do I need prior yoga or meditation experience?

    No. Balanced Rock retreats are intentionally designed to welcome all levels, from complete beginners to longtime practitioners. Our skilled instructors offer variations so everyone feels supported, comfortable, and empowered.

    What should I pack for a lodge-based retreat?

    We encourage guests to bring comfortable clothing for yoga and movement, warm layers, outdoor footwear, a reusable water bottle, and any personal items you need for rest and reflection. A full packing list will be provided, and all yoga props will available at the lodge.

    What is the lodging situation like?

    Lodges vary by retreat but are generally cozy, communal spaces with comfortable shared or private rooms, warm gathering areas, and access to the surrounding natural landscape. Many offer modern amenities while preserving a sense of simplicity and connection to place.

    I have dietary restrictions—can they be accommodated?

    Absolutely. Balanced Rock retreats offer wholesome, nourishing meals with vegetarian, gluten-free, and dairy-free options available. If you have allergies or specific needs, you will be able to share those in your registration form and we’ll do our best to ensure you are cared for.

Meet Your Retreat Facilitators

HEATHER SULLIVAN • Retreat Leader

Heather has lived in the Yosemite area for over 20 years. The steep granite valley walls, seasonal change of the river song, and community of animals and humans have deeply shaped her being and worldview. Co-Founder of Balanced Rock, she continues to serve as Executive Director using her skills of non-profit management and leadership, group facilitation, community building, mentorship, and program development to hold the vision and lead the organization through its continued evolution.

She delights in creating unique, powerful programs and supporting staff and instructors to shine their magic in the world. She is a gifted teacher and seasoned mountain guide at heart and makes sure to get in the field as an instructor each season.

ARIANA NOELKE • Retreat Chef

Ariana is a chef and educator who brings warmth, creativity, and a deep sense of care to every meal. As the retreat chef for yoga and wellness gatherings, she designs menus that are Ayurvedically-inspired—nourishing body and spirit through seasonal balance, color, and intention.

Rooted in the bounty of the Ojai Valley, Ariana’s cooking celebrates the citrus groves, vibrant produce, and bright herbs of the season. Her meals invite guests to slow down, reconnect with the rhythms of nature, and gather in laughter and gratitude. Each dish is crafted to support renewal, mindfulness, and the simple beauty of eating well in a place that feels alive.
